Stability becomes one of the prerequisite factors in dental implant success. Although there are many methods to assess the stability of dental implant, some of them lack of sensitivity and objectivity. Instead, resonance frequency analysis provides a non-invasive quantitative measurement to evaluate the stability of dental implants. Screwing the transducer onto the fixture, implant stability can be measured by resonance frequency analysis. The change of dental implant stability can be monitored since the time of implant placement. Moreover, ideal loading time can be determined based on the implant stability. The resonance frequency analysis turns standard protocol into individual protocol according to the development of osseointegration.
